Driving review for initially 100km:-
I was afraid from the very start of Manual car because I have taken a test ride of it and found the gear shifter very hard, one needs to be patience and use little force to shift gears but with time I found that shifts are getting smother and by 1000km one can shift without any much force.
2nd point on mileage, I am not getting much but my Odo meter is showing an average of 10-12km/ltr and I am expecting it will start increasing post-1000 km once the engine is smooth and fresh oil has been replaced for the car.
On tire, from day 1 I wanted to replace them because these are very low-profile highways, and for an offroader these tires are useless.
Before delivery, I was getting a lot of deals but due to a delay in delivery, my contact very not offering any good deals as the demand for these stock tires is not in the market.
